The resolution source for this market is a consensus of credible reporting.Major AI and tech unicorns are accelerating IPO preparations amid a robust 2026 market rebound fueled by investor appetite for artificial intelligence exposure. OpenAI is advancing confidential S-1 work with Goldman Sachs and Morgan Stanley targeting a potential late-2026 or 2027 debut, while Databricks, valued above $100 billion with strong AI revenue growth, is positioned as IPO-ready for early 2026. Discord has already filed confidentially for a Q1 2026 listing, and SpaceX maintains high market-implied odds for completion before year-end. Key catalysts ahead include regulatory filings, earnings momentum, and broader equity market stability, though founder reluctance at firms like Stripe and shifting timelines remain swing factors that could alter outcomes.
